Softball falls to Paradise, 3-1

PARADISE – In a game with first place in District 8-3A on the line, it wasn’t too surprising on who would get the start in the pitching circle for Jacksboro.

Senior Hanah Drennan, who came on in relief in the first meeting with Paradise and struck out seven of the nine batters she faced, got the nod last Friday and responded in kind. Drennan allowed just one run on two hits over the first four innings to keep her teammates in the fray with the district leaders.

Thompson sets school record at 8-3A Meet

Jacksboro’s track teams competed well in the first day of the District 8-3A track meet Monday at Tiger Stadium.

Field events and running prelims were held Monday with the running finals set for Thursday. 1st race is set for 5:30 p.m.

The top four finishers qualify for area April 19. Sophomore Baylee Thompson won both the discus, setting a school record with a 123’8” throw, and the shot put with a 38’ 1/4” effort. Leah Plaster qualified for area in the shot put, finishing second in the event with a 36’1”.

JHS golfers take top District 8-3A honors

BURKBURNETT – Jacksboro’s boys and girls golf teams swept past their District 8-3A foes to take top honors at the district meet here Wednesday afternoon.

The boys posted a team score of 345, 17 strokes better than runner-up Holliday. Dalton Harp led the charge with an 84, good enough for third-place medalist. Ethan Sanchez and Brady Burnett finished right behind with rounds of 85 and 86, respectively with Reno Rollans firing a 90. Hunter Hackley had a 106 but the low four rounds comprise a team score.

Perrin girls rout Lipan, 13-3

PERRIN – A 15-hit attack and a solid pitching performance were enough for the Lady Pirate softball team to take control and post a 13-3, six-inning home-field win over Lipan March 23.

The visitors jumped out to a 2-0 lead in the top of the first but the hostesses took control with a four-run first and added a run in the bottom of the third. The squads traded fourth-inning runs before Perrin broke things open with a six-run sixth to end the game on mercy rule.

JHS track teams run in Bowie

BOWIE – Jacksboro’s track teams competed in the Jackrabbit Relays last Thursday.

On the girls' side, Baylee Thompson had a personal best in the shot put, winning with a 39’8 1/2” with teammate Leah Plaster second with a 36’3 1/2”. Thompson also won the discus with a 121’2” just six inches shy of her personal best at the PK Relays the previous Saturday. Plaster finished 6th in the event.

Both the 800-meter and 1,600-meter relay teams picked up points and continue to improve.
